Halt of Work Notice for an Agricultural Room in An-Nabi Elyas / Qalqilya governorate

 

  •  Violation: Halt of Work and Construction notice.
  • Location: An-Nabi Elyas village / Qalqilya governorate.
  • Date: January 3rd 2022.
  • Perpetrators: The Israeli Civil Administration.
  • Victims: Citizen Faisal Taha.

Description:

Monday, January 3rd 2022 , the Israeli Occupation raided An-Nabi Elyas village southeast Qalqilya , and served a halt of work notice for an agricultural room built of bricks and steal sheets with a total area of 30 m2 , on the pretext of building without a license.

According to the notice number (32731) , the occupation sat January 26th 2022 , as the date of the inspection subcommittee , in Beit El military court to decide the fate of the structure.

 

About An-Nabi Elyas village:[1]

It is located 6 km to the east of Qalqiliya governorate and is edged by Izbbet Al-Tabib and Aslah villages from the east, Arab Abu Fardeh area from the west, Jayyous town from the north and Ras Tayreh from the south.

The village populates 1399 inhabitants (2017 census) that are relative to three main families namely ( Hannun, Khleif and Majd).

Nabi Elyas has a total area of 4435 dunums, of which 123 dunums are considered the village’s built-up area. Noteworthy, more than 2200 dunums of the area were isolated behind the apartheid wall and became subject to colonial activities of takeover and expansion.

The targeted agricultural structure belong to farmer Faisal Taha , from Qalqilya , who supports a family of 6 , among them 4 males (2 females and 2 children).

During the past years, The Israeli Occupation intensified assaults against agricultural lands , and residential and agricultural facilities in An-Nabi Elyas , especially the villages nearby the bypass road, where a number of structures were demolished during the past 12 months.
